    There actually was a great post by @ssaka at the other place that discussed beetle hatching temps/humidity. While I don't remember everything in his post, what I found fascinating was that below 70/70 usually prevents hatching, but also over a certain temp/RH level also prevents hatching. Unfortunately, those higher temps/Rh will make your cigars pretty soggy.

    Anyone with a coolerdor and a refrigerator can bring down the coolerdor's temperature easily. Wrap a cold can or two of whatever beverage you have handy in a dish towel or hand towel, put that into a ziplock bag, and place in cooler until the interior temperature is more to your liking (or the cans have warmed up to the same temp as the cooler). The towels will provide insulation keep the temperature from dropping too quickly, while the plastic bag keeps moisture from the air inside the cooler from condensing and lowering the RH. You can also use a refreezable "blue ice" pack; just wrap it a little more and it will probably stay cold for several hours.
